Activision Blizzard employees launch petition urging CEO to resign

More than 1,330 employees at video game maker Activision Blizzard have signed a petition calling for the resignation of longtime CEO Bobby Kotick, who has been accused of ignoring complaints of alleged sexual harassment from female workers. Judge approves $626 million settlement in Flint water crisis case

A federal judge has approved a partial settlement that will provide $626.25 million to tens of thousands of Flint, Michigan, residents who for years were impacted by exposure to lead in their drinking water. Department of Justice sues Uber for overcharging disabled people

The U.S. Department of Justice has filed a lawsuit against Uber for charging disabled passengers with a fee should they need additional time to board vehicles, the department announced Wednesday. Political newcomer Edward Durr defeauts New Jersey state Senate president Steve Sweeney in shocking upset

New Jersey’s longtime state Senate president Steve Sweeney, the second-most powerful lawmaker in the state, was defeated in a stunning upset by a political newcomer.  The Associated Press called the race for Republican Edward Durr on Thursday morning, with Durr holding a lead of more than 2,000 votes.
